Tatlı Küçük Yalancılar
Tatlı Küçük Yalancılar (Sweet Little Liars) is a Turkish psychological thriller drama series[1] produced by O3 Media and aired for the first time on July 6, 2015 on Star TV.[2] Based on the popular American series Pretty Little Liars,[3] it stars Burak Deniz, Şükrü Özyıldız, Bensu Soral, Büşra Develi, Melisa Şenolsun, Dilan Çiçek Deniz, and Beste Kökdemir.

Plot
The plot follows the lives of four friends, Aslı, Selin, Ebru and Hande after the disappearance of Açelya, the fifth friend of the group. A year later they begin to receive anonymous messages from someone calling himself "A". The messages threaten to reveal all their secrets, even some that only Açelya knew.
